Catch 22 is an American post-war novel written by Joseph Heller. It is one of the interesting pieces of American literature juggling dark humor, war issues, bleakness, satire, silliness, wordplay and serious theme. Initially the book looks like a noose of loose strands but as the plot progresses, we find that very deftly, Heller has been able to surface the absurdity of war and the human condition itself. It is a world of madness, where each character fits in perfectly well with his personal streak of eccentricity.

Quantum computers are hypothetical devices with higher computational power than a traditional computer. The classical system involves bits as the smallest unit of data, that is represented by 0 or 1, while quantum computers are made up of quantum bits, also known as qubits. Unlike the conventional computer, where a bit has to be either 0 or 1, quantum mechanics grants a qubit to be in both the states at the same time. The Eternal Nazi: From Mauthausen to Cairo, the Relentless Pursuit of SS Doctor Aribert Heim is written by Nicholas Kulish and Souad Mekhennet. It is a semi biographical sketch of SS officer Aribert Heim, a medical doctor by profession and an able ice hockey player. He was serving at Mauthausen during 1941. People who survived the concentration camp reported that he used to take pleasure in operating healthy people without giving them anesthesia. Recent research lead by Prof Noriyuki Matsunaga and his team of astronomers at the University of Tokyo suggest that our understanding of Milky Way Galaxy is still not complete. The team discovered that major portion of the region surrounding the center of our Galaxy is devoid of young stars, a study that contradicts the conventional thinking. Researchers a Swiss Federal Institute of Technology, Lausanne have developed a technique that can be used for both, fabricating bio-inspired robots and secondly, furnishing them with higher configurations. Their newly constructed platform also helps in examining and researching robot designs along with their various modes of locomotion. Result of their platform is the production of complex yet reconfigurable microrobots – the nanobots can change their own shape by rearranging the connectivity of their parts- with high throughput.
